The 2011 Haas School of Business Women in Leadership Conference is dedicated to leaders who have challenged the status quo. We seek to celebrate women who have created their own paths, become pioneers in their fields, and achieved both professional and personal successes. We recognize that not all leadership tactics apply neatly to all. Instead our conference is driven to help attendees understand how to redefine their leadership styles and make it their own.
Date: Saturday, March 5, 2011
Where: Haas School of Business, University of California at Berkeley
What:
- Three inspiring keynote addresses. You won’t want to miss these extraordinary women, including:
o Nancy Mahon, Esq., SVP M·A·C Cosmetics and Executive Director M·A·C Aids Fund
o Eileen Crane, CEO/Founding Winemaker, Domaine Carneros
o Heather L. Mason, President Abbott Diabetes Care and Senior Vice President Abbott Laboratories
- Industry panels. Participate in a lively discussion about industry trends, career paths and business challenges, and learn from speakers’ and audience members’ unique experiences. Select from several panels, ranging from healthcare to energy to corporate social responsibility.
- Networking lunch. Meet and mingle with attendees, speakers and recruiters.
- Personal development workshops. Build skills and acquire new tools to help you chart your course.
- Networking reception. Continue your conversations with speakers, participants, and recruiters with a glass of wine and some refreshments.
